Eap tls if necessary will fragment the packet and send it to the destination. Outer tunnel protects the mschapv2 handshakes outer tunnel. Mar 16, 2020 stateless session resume support for eaptls. Eap tls stands for extensible authentication protocoltransport layer security. Combining these together, the following tls ciphersuites are mandatorytoimplement in any. Ppp also defines an extensible link control protocol, which allows negotiation of an authentication protocol for authenticating its peer before allowing network layer protocols to transmit over the link. Oct 23, 2014 it means that on your client you have validate server cert enabled and the client doesnt have cppms cert in its cert store. Authentication protocol eap, ietf rfc 3748 june 2004. Whatever the choice by the sp might be, by using cbsa, the sp has the ability to combine all the. Introduction his document presents an overview on some security issues that affect the extensible authentication protocol as defined by the ietf rfc. Eap tls, eap ttls, eap sim, eap aka rfc 2716 ppp eap tls rfc 2865 radius authentication rfc 3579 radius support for eap rfc 3580 ieee 802.
Most supplicants support eap mschapv2 for the inner exchange, which allows peap to use external user databases. Finally, it describes how the tls unique channel binding may be used to bind patnc exchanges to the eap tunnel method, defeating maninthemiddle mitm attacks such as the asokan attack. Eap is defined in rfc 3748 and updated in rfc 5247. Transport level security tls provides for mutual authentication, integrity. Eap potp, eap gtc, eap tlv, eap aka, eap experimental, eap md5 rfc 2548 microsoft vendorspecific radius attributes rfc 2716 ppp eap tls rfc 2865 radius authentication rfc 3579 radius support for eap rfc 3580 ieee 802. If another authentication mechanism than peap is preferred, e. It is defined in rfc 3748, which made rfc 2284 obsolete, and is updated by rfc. Since the iv is a known value in methods such as eaptls transport layer. Extensible authentication protocol eap is an authentication framework frequently used in network and internet connections. How is extensible authentication protocoltransport layer security abbreviated. Windows 10 enterprise has a feature called credential guard. Then i went to the rfc and added the 4 octet length field and tls flags in the packet. Extensible authentication protocol eap security issues. What is the abbreviation for extensible authentication protocoltransport layer security.
This public key as part of the certificate is send to the server and used to encrypt the communication between the client and server. While configuring eaptls protocol settings, you can enable stateless session resumption for eaptls sessions. Microsoft is announcing the availability of an update for supported editions of windows 7, windows server 2008 r2, windows 8, windows 8. All certificates have to be in the itut standard x. Introduction the netconf protocol defines a simple mechanism through which a network device can be managed, configuration data information can be retrieved, and new configuration data can be uploaded and manipulated. Protocol overview pt eap has two phases that follow each other in strict sequence. Tekradius also supports rfc 2868 radius attributes for tunnel protocol support and rfc 3079 deriving keys for use with. Rfc 5216 the eaptls authentication protocol ietf tools. The extensible authentication protocol eap, specified in rfc 3748 4, is a. Eaptls extensible authentication protocoltransport layer. Session resumption the purpose of the sessionid within the tls protocol is to allow for improved efficiency in the case where a peer repeatedly attempts to authenticate to an eap server within a short period of time. The extensible authentication protocol eap is a ppp extension that provides. Rfc 4017 eap method requirements for wireless lans march 2005 1. The uicc offers suitable possibilities for the implementation of some of these eap.
Sequence of steps that take place in an eaptls conversation. Here is an excerpt from rfc 5216 eaptls, section 2. Cbrs network services private networks cbrs alliance. The eaptls client certificate binds the clients identity to a public key. Introduction the netconf protocol defines a simple mechanism through which a network device can be managed, configuration data information can be. Eap tls is an involved configuration, please refer to your radius vendor documentation for configuration specifics. You need to either manually import the cert in to the client or uncheck that setting. Finally, it describes how the tlsunique channel binding may be used to bind patnc exchanges to the eap tunnel method, defeating maninthemiddle mitm attacks such as the asokan attack. How to configure server security red hat jboss enterprise. Extensible authentication protocols for ieee standards 802. Peat protected extensible authentication protocol 3. Rfc 4017 extensible authentication protocol eap method. Transport layer security tls provides for mutual authentication, integrityprotected ciphersuite negotiation, and key exchange between two endpoints.
Eaptls rfc 2716 is using the tls protocol rfc 2246, which is the internet engineering task forces ietfs latest version of the secure socket layer ssl protocol. Rfc 5281 extensible authentication protocol tunneled transport layer security authenticated protocol version 0 eap ttlsv0. Tls provides a way to use certificates for both user and server authentication and for dynamic session key generation. Rfc 7170 tunnel extensible authentication protocol teap.
Strong password based eaptls authentication protocol for. Teap is a tunnelbased eap method that enables secure communication between a peer and a server by using the transport layer security tls protocol to establish a mutually authenticated tunnel. Tls module will perform its operations on the data and hands back to eap tls. During the handshake phase, the server is authenticated to the client or client and server are mutually authenticated using standard tls. The extensible authentication protocol eap, defined in rfc 3748, provides support for multiple authentication methods. The requirement for a clientside certificate is what gives eaptls. Cisco ise supports session ticket extension as described in rfc 5077. Eap authentication protocols for wlans should be done, such as what decisions are made and when. We are happily within reason supporting peapmschapv2. If you want to use the tls based eap authentication methods in tls 1. Rfc 4346 the primary goal of the tls protocol is to provide privacy and data integrity between two communicating applications. Nist sp 800120, recommendation for eap methods used in. Eappeapmschapv2 chap means challenge response authentication protocol authenticates a user by questioninganswering handshakes without sending the actual password over.
It is often used for wireless networking and one of the stronger forms of authentication since both the wireless client and server are authenticated with certificates. Were using eap tls here and windows 7 and 8 machines are added to a specific ad group and get the certificate via gpo. Cbrs network services private networks technical report version v0. Tekradius radius server for windows tekradius is a radius server for. Ttls, only a small number of configuration options needs to be changed. Ttls and peap comparison called the inner eap exchange. I some risks are mitigated by employing suitable eap method i protection of the protocol providing secure channel i ipsec, radsec radius over tls i radius support for eap rfc 3579 802. Other common eap methods supported by peap supplicants are eap tls and generic token card eap gtc. It provides authentication to devices attached to a local area network port, establishing a. Abstract the extensible authentication protocol eap, defined in rfc 3748, enables. Certificate requirements when you use eaptls or peap with. Open sbutcherarm mentioned this pull request apr 3, 2018. A cisco secure access control server acs that is configured to use extensible authentication protocoltransport layer security eap tls to authenticate users to the network will allow access to any user.
Eaptls extensible authentication protocol transport layer security provides client and server authentication. Im trying to determine if it is worth deploying an entire pki infrastructure, or if peap is the way to go. Eap tls rfc 2716 is using the tls protocol rfc 2246, which is the internet engineering task forces ietfs latest version of the secure socket layer ssl protocol. The pointtopoint protocol ppp provides a standard method for transporting multiprotocol datagrams over pointtopoint links. Windows 10 peap authentication failure secure of on. Rfc extensible authentication protocol method for 3rd generation authentication and key agreement eap aka, january canonical url. Rfc 5216 eap tls authentication protocol march 2008 2. In eaptls the client and server mutually authenticate each other based. Eap tls abbreviation stands for extensible authentication protocoltransport layer security. Transport layer security tls provides for mutual authentication, integrity protected ciphersuite negotiation, and key exchange between two endpoints. Once open system authentication phase completes, eap starts. I tried comparing the tls data byte by byte to a tls connection happening over. Designing an eaptls client hello message stack overflow.
Eap typically runs directly over data link layers such as pointtopoint protocol ppp or ieee 802, without requiring ip. This document defines eap tls, which includes support for certificatebased mutual authentication and key derivation. The client presents the ticket to ise to resume a session. Cisco ise creates a ticket and sends it to an eaptls client. Tls allows clientserver applications to communicate across a public network while. Abstract eapttls is an eap extensible authentication protocol method that encapsulates a tls transport layer security session, consisting of a handshake phase and a data phase. Extensible authentication protocol transport layer. However, since your comment the ietf eap methods update emu working group has passed eapgpsk and others are in progress. It is defined in rfc 3748, which made rfc 2284 obsolete, and is updated by rfc 5247. I can see peap eap tls exists as a method, but i couldnt find a reason to add this extra layer to things. I had to disable credential guard and device guard on the host to do the host authentication we are doing. Is peap any less secure than eap tls for securing wireless networks. Eap tls uses a user certificate to authenticate the supplicant to the server.
One of the most applicable techniques in the eap methods is eap transport. I tried comparing the tls data byte by byte to a tls connection happening over tcp, and i can see that the fields for client hello 16 in hex, tls version 0x0301. Request pdf extensible authentication protocols for ieee standards 802. The extensible authentication protocol eap provides support for multiple authentication methods. By merging access networks together, policy and access. Can i authenticate a windows computer against ise using eap tls with a computeronly.
Rfc 4072 is an eap encapsulation for diameter, not a method. Abstract the extensible authentication protocol eap, defined in rfc 3748, provides support for multiple authentication methods. Store that data in a data structure with any other required info. Consequently, tls can only be used by organisations with a certificate authority ca that issues user certificates. The purpose of this document is to provide a practical guide to securing red hat jboss enterprise application platform jboss eap. Eap is an authentication framework for providing the transport and usage of material and parameters generated by eap methods. This functionality is completely left to the domain. Rfc 4347 datagram transport layer security rfc 4346 tls protocol version 1. Eap tpm 1 is a new authentication protocol for wireless lans. However, since your comment the ietf eap methods update emu working group has passed eap gpsk and others are in progress. Eap tls is required to use clientside certificates in addition to serverside certificate.
Rc4 128bit and rda 1024 and 2048 bit authentication ieee 802. Release notes for cisco identity services engine, release 2. Blakewilson safenet august 2008 extensible authentication protocol tunneled transport layer security authenticated protocol version 0 eap ttlsv0 status of this memo this memo provides information for the internet community. Within the tunnel, tlv objects are used to convey authenticationrelated data between the eap peer and the eap. Because it requires both the supplicant and the authentication server to have. The mac server is running mavericks and were using the apple profile editor to create the mobileconfig file. Eap tls should get the complete tls data from the peer. Nov 15, 2019 discusses the certificate requirements when you use extensible authentication protocoltransport layer security eap tls or protected extensible authentication protocol peap eap tls in windows server 2003, windows xp, and windows 2000. Microsoft has developed eap tls which is an authentication protocol based on tls. Authentication, wlan, wpa, wpa2, tls, ttls, eap tls, eap ttls, leap, seapv0, seapv1, chap, eap fast, eap psk i. Seems like this should be an easy question, but after doing some reading, im still a little confused.
Eap does not include security for the conversation between the client and the authentication server, so it is usually used within a secure tunnel technology such as tls, ttls, or mschap. This document defines the ppp extensible authentication protocol. Eap is an authentication framework for providing the transport and usage of material and parameters generated by eap. Rfc 5247 extensible authentication protocol eap key. Tls 26, used to establish a tunnel key tk between two parties. Whereas with eap ttls, client authentication seems optional according to the rfc and the tls handshake is only done to create a secure tunnel which can be used to perform other authentication methods. Extensible authentication protocol, or eap, is an authentication framework frequently used in eap transport layer security eap tls, defined in rfc. A read is counted each time someone views a publication summary such as the title, abstract, and list of authors, clicks on a figure, or views or downloads the fulltext. Eap fragmentation implementations and behavior cisco. Vulnerability in cisco secure access control server eap. Technical description dls certificate management for 802. The protocol allows the device to expose a full, formal application programming interface api. The extensible authentication protocol eap, specified in ietf rfc 3748 18, is a framework.
Enhancing eaptls authentication protocol for ieee 802. To my understanding, it does basically the same thing. Eap tls is defined as extensible authentication protocoltransport layer security somewhat frequently. Other common eap methods supported by peap supplicants are eap tls and generic token card eap.
Within the tunnel, tlv objects are used to convey authenticationrelated data between the eap peer and the eap server. More specifically, this guide details how to secure all of the management interfaces on jboss eap. Transport layer security is an eap type for authentication based upon x. Eaptls rfc 2716 is using the tls protocol rfc 2246, which is the internet engineering task force s ietfs latest version of the secure socket layer ssl protocol. Rfc 5281 eap ttlsv0 rfc 5246 the tls protocol version 1. I would also like to start supporting eap tls for certain clients. Rfc 5281 extensible authentication protocol tunneled. Eaptls, aaa fastconnect removes the requirement for. Once radius has been configured appropriately, please refer to our documentation for instructions on configuring an ssid for wpa2enterprise with radius. The tls type is based on the transport layer security tls 6 protocol, which uses public key cryptography for authentication and production of keys that can be used to encrypt data.
1044 1271 665 582 238 382 6 1633 570 592 731 791 1321 1391 23 1117 1368 184 441 615 37 1182 1108 1070 226 27 78 12 397 448 1245 1393 765 521 271 673 1422